Compression socks used to be something I avoided at all costs.

I pictured them as tight, uncomfortable and just downright unappealing. The thought of squeezing my legs into the constricting tubes made me cringe, and honestly, I never understood the hype — until I found myself preparing for a 12-hour-plus flight to Hawaii for my honeymoon.

That’s when I decided to give compression socks a real shot, and that’s how I discovered the Comrad Nylon Knee-High Compression Socks.

I’d heard from a few fellow travelers that compression socks could be a game-changer for long flights, helping to keep circulation going and preventing swelling. So, pairing them with my trusty New Balance sneakers, I reluctantly slipped on a pair of Comrad socks.

Amazon

Right off the bat, I was pleasantly surprised. The material felt soft and breathable, and certainly not the sweaty, itchy nightmare I expected. Coming from the chilly, damp weather of New Jersey and heading into the warm Pacific sun, I was worried about my feet overheating or feeling suffocated, but these socks were extremely breathable, keeping my legs comfortable from takeoff to touchdown.

What really impressed me was the graduated compression design. These socks apply 15 to 20 mmHg of pressure, with the tightest fit at the ankle, gradually easing up the leg, promoting better blood flow and reducing swelling. Unlike other compression socks I’d tried before, these didn’t feel like a tourniquet, cutting off my circulation. Instead, they provided a gentle, supportive hug for my legs that made a long flight feel way more manageable.

So no, I didn’t experience that numb, pins-and-needles feeling. Only comfort here.
